Minutes — Management Meeting, Fennimore House

Present: ops, finance, HR leads. Main item: the hiring freeze in the Ravelin Services division. Agreed to hold all open roles there through end of quarter, with two exceptions for safety-critical posts — HR to handle case-by-case. Backfills elsewhere unaffected, so don't panic the other divisions. Finance will model headcount savings and report back in three weeks. For our incoming director: this connects to the bigger picture, which we've summarised confidentially below.

management briefing: Headcount on the Quenael team goes from 9 to 80 by the end of July. Gross margin on Quenael came in at 15 percent against a plan of 20 percent.

**Vendor note: Inkmill markdown pipeline**

Rendering for Parchway docs is outsourced to Inkmill under an annual contract, renewing each March. They handle sanitization and PDF export; we own the upload queue. SLA: 4-hour response on rendering failures. Escalate only after two failed retries. Their support desk is reachable at the address below.

billing contact of hahaf-baguf = zorael.tammir.jorius@sivrelhq.internal

# Artifact Signing — Farecraft Rules Engine

Plugin authors extending the Farecraft shipping-fee rules engine must sign every packaged rule bundle before submission. The marketplace validator checks signatures at upload time and rejects unsigned or mismatched artifacts with no retry grace period. Use the standard bundler tool; it handles hashing and manifest generation automatically. For sandbox testing only, bundles may be signed with the shared development key published here, shown below.

rollout seal: bky4_DFM9